AI Summary

  • Amends section 10-262h of the general statutes to revise the equalization aid grant formula for education cost-sharing
  • Increases the entitlement amount of education cost-sharing grants paid to rural towns
  • Aims to better reflect the educational funding needs of rural communities in Connecticut

Legislative Description

An Act Increasing Education Cost-sharing Grants For Rural Towns.
